The application of LDI (Laser Direct Imaging) technology in the PCB (Printed Circuit Board) sector is extensive and profound

The application of LDI (Laser Direct Imaging) technology in the PCB (Printed Circuit Board) sector is extensive and profound, boasting a high level of technological sophistication that addresses numerous industry challenges. Incorporating Youdi Laser's LDI equipment, let's delve into the application, technological intricacies, and the pain points it resolves in the industry.

Firstly, LDI technology utilizes a laser beam to directly project patterns onto photoresist-coated circuit boards, facilitating the transfer of intricate circuit designs without the need for traditional photolithography machines or photographic tools. Compared to traditional imaging processes, LDI offers superior imaging quality and efficiency.

In terms of technological sophistication, LDI technology stands out in several aspects. It eliminates the need for physical masks, reducing defects and enhancing product yield and reliability. Furthermore, the small diameter of the laser spot enables higher resolution and precision, meeting the demands for finer lines and microscopic features in PCB manufacturing. Additionally, the high-speed nature of LDI technology accelerates production workflows, leading to cost reduction.

Addressing industry pain points, LDI technology plays a pivotal role. It resolves the inefficiencies associated with creating and replacing physical masks in traditional PCB manufacturing, thus boosting production efficiency. Additionally, LDI's ability to handle finer and more complex patterns enhances product quality and reliability. Furthermore, by eliminating the use of chemicals, LDI technology reduces environmental pollution, aligning with eco-friendly and sustainable development goals.
